Once you’ve honed your observation skills, experiment with composition to highlight these extraordinary moments. Techniques such as the rule of thirds, leading lines, and framing can transform an ordinary scene into a captivating image. Additionally, don’t shy away from using your camera settings creatively; adjusting the aperture to create a blurred background can emphasize your subject, while playing with shutter speed can capture movement in dynamic ways. Ultimately, the key to unlocking the magic lies in your ability to fuse technical knowledge with a keen artistic eye, allowing you to narrate a unique story through each photograph you take.
